Document Requirements
To apply for a Mexico permanent residents visa, you will need a color photograph with specific dimensions: 31.0x39.0 mm, with a resolution of 600 dpi. The background should be a light gray (#eeeeee). The photo must be suitable for both print and online submission. Ensure the photo is recent and clearly shows your face.
